Program Overview

Module 1: Introduction to Agile

⏳ 30 minutes

  • Overview of Agile methodologies and their benefits.

  • Comparison with traditional project management approaches.

Module 2: Scrum Framework

⏳ 1 hour

  • Roles: Product Owner, Scrum Master, Development Team.

  • Ceremonies: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Review, Sprint Retrospective.

  • Artifacts: Product Backlog, Sprint Backlog, Increment.

Module 3: Kanban Method

⏳ 45 minutes

  • Principles of Kanban: Visualizing work, limiting work in progress, managing flow.

  • Implementing Kanban boards and metrics.

Module 4: Agile Planning & Execution

⏳ 1 hour

  • Creating and managing product backlogs.

  • Estimating user stories and planning sprints.

  • Executing and delivering increments.

Module 5: Agile Tools & Techniques

⏳ 45 minutes

  • Introduction to Jira and Trello for Agile project management.

  • Using boards, epics, stories, and sprints in these tools.

Module 6: Real-World Applications

⏳ 1 hour

  • Case studies of Agile implementation in various industries.

  • Challenges and solutions in adopting Agile practices.

Job Outlook

  • High Demand for Agile Skills: Agile methodologies are widely adopted across industries, leading to a high demand for professionals with Agile expertise.
  • Career Opportunities: Roles such as Scrum Master, Product Owner, Agile Coach, and Agile Project Manager are in high demand.
  • Industry Adoption: Companies in software development, IT, finance, and healthcare are increasingly adopting Agile practices to enhance project delivery and team collaboration.
